It's the question he gets asked all the time by executives who are also parents, partners, and people trying to hold it all together: how do you actually do all of it without shortchanging any of it?
Dan doesn't frame this as balance. He frames it as integration. In this episode he gets specific about what that looks like in practice, from bringing kids to business dinners to the 30-second video message that changed his relationship with his oldest daughter. This one is for single parents, recently remarried parents, blended family parents, and anyone trying to be fully present at work and at home.
